Scentre Group Launches Westfield AW16 Fashion Campaign ‘Own Your Story’

Today, Scentre Group launched its national Autumn/Winter 16 fashion campaign ‘Own Your Story’ across 35 Westfield shopping centres and announced Delta Goodrem and Yaya Deng as its two new Westfield style ambassadors.

The fully-integrated campaign empowers shoppers to embrace their individuality and express themselves through style.

In two short films, ‘Own Your Story’ sees Delta and Yaya each share advice with their younger self on topics spanning fashion to self-confidence and career, based on lessons they’ve learned, told from their now adult perspective.

The campaign will launch today across earned, owned and paid channels, including website, the Smartscreen Network of 1,200 screens across 34 Westfield shopping centres, custom publishing through Bauer Media, catch-up TV, YouTube, radio, native content across various digital publications, PR, mobile video and social.

Sarah Cleggett, general manager marketing at Scentre Group said, “‘Own Your Story’ acknowledges the role fashion plays in how we express ourselves to the outside world. It’s about empowering shoppers to embrace their individuality through style.

“We have the largest range of international, local and designer retailers in our centres and online at www.westfield.com.au, so customers can shop the season’s latest looks and find fashion that tells their story.”

The campaign films include key seasonal looks from international and Australian retailers including Witchery, Kookai, Colette, Carla Zampatti, Dion Lee and Jo Mercer.

Scentre Group will launch the ‘Own Your Story’ integrated national campaign through Sibling Agency, the purpose-built, full-service agency offering established by the STW Group dedicated to the Westfield brand.
